4. Postpartum - The Shield
The Shield's phenomenal fifth season saw the Strike Team's chickens come home to roost when their myriad corrupt actions were investigated by doggedly determined Internal Affairs officer Jon Kavanaugh (Forest Whitaker).
Kavanaugh manages to make charges stick on one member of the team, Lem (Kenny Johnson), who he attempts to "flip" and make rat out the rest of the Strike Team.
Ultimately team leader Vic Mackey (Michael Chiklis) arranges for Lem to instead flee to Mexico, but fellow member Shane Vendrell (Walton Goggins) is tricked into believing that Lem will turn on the team, and so takes drastic steps to prevent it.
In a devastating, infuriating scene as Lem sits in his car and prepares to run to Mexico, Shane suddenly drops a live grenade in Lem's lap, the resulting explosion mortally wounding him.
Seeing Lem, the moral compass of the Strike Team, suffer such a brutal death - from someone he loved like a brother, even - was absolutely infuriating, especially as it was completely avoidable.
But this was also a necessary, narrative-energising event that set in motion the show's incredible final two seasons, leading to Vic and Shane both reckoning for their respective actions in the jaw-dropping series finale.
